Character Arc

Lacie Pound lives in a pastel-colored near-future society where every social interaction is rated on a five-star scale, and a person's aggregate score determines their access to housing, transportation, employment, and social standing. Lacie is a 4.2, respectable but not elite, and she is desperately obsessed with breaking into the 4.5-and-above tier that would qualify her for a discount on a luxury apartment in a prestigious gated community. She is performatively pleasant, meticulously curating every smile, laugh, and social media post to maximize her rating. Bryce Dallas Howard plays her with a brittle, desperate cheerfulness that barely conceals the anxiety beneath — a woman who has internalized an entire system of social control and made it her religion.

Lacie's opportunity arrives when her childhood friend Naomi (Alice Eve), a glamorous 4.8, invites her to be maid of honor at her wedding — a high-profile event guaranteed to boost Lacie's score through proximity to high-rated guests. But the journey to the wedding becomes a cascading disaster. A cancelled flight, a confrontation with a rental car agent, a disastrous encounter with a truck driver rated 1.4, and increasingly erratic behavior send Lacie's score plummeting. Each setback strips away another layer of her carefully maintained facade until she arrives at the wedding disheveled, ranting, and rated so low she is essentially a social outcast. The episode's devastating final scene finds Lacie in a holding cell, finally free from the tyranny of her rating, screaming obscenities at a fellow prisoner — and for the first time in the entire episode, genuinely laughing with authentic emotion. Her liberation comes only through total social destruction, suggesting that the system's grip can only be broken by losing everything it promises.

Bryce Dallas Howard plays Lacie Pound in the Black Mirror episode "Nosedive" (Season 3, Episode 1). Her performance earned widespread acclaim for capturing the brittle desperation of a woman enslaved by social approval metrics.

Nosedive depicts a society where people rate every interaction on a 1-to-5 scale, with aggregate scores determining social and economic status. Lacie Pound is obsessed with raising her 4.2 rating to access luxury housing, but her journey to a friend's wedding becomes a cascading social disaster that destroys her rating entirely.

While fictional, the Nosedive rating system has drawn comparisons to China's social credit system, ride-sharing and delivery app ratings, and the social dynamics of platforms like Instagram and TikTok where quantified approval shapes behavior and self-worth.

Lacie ends up in a detention cell with her social implant removed. Free from the rating system for the first time, she exchanges profane insults with a fellow inmate and laughs genuinely — finding authentic human connection only after losing everything the system valued.
